Moved procedure iniconst inside module comconst. Removed useless
variables of module comconst: im, jm, lllm, imp1, jmp1, lllmm1,
lllmp1, lcl, cotot, unsim. Move definition of dtvr that was in
dynetat0 and etat0 to iniconst. Moved comparison of dtvr from day_step
and start.nc that was in gcm to dynetat0. Moved call to disvert out of
iniconst. Moved call to iniconst in gcm before call to dynetat0.

Removed unused argument pvteta of physiq (not used either in LMDZ).
